Is Penge dangerous?
Penge and Cator is the second most dangerous place in the Bromley borough, according to police statistics. There were 746 reports of theft and 601 violent crimes.

Why is Penge called Penge?
The name Penge derives from Celtic words meaning ‘head of the wood’; Pencoed in Wales has exactly the same origin. This is one of the few Celtic place names in London and suggests the survival of a native British contingent after Anglo-Saxon colonisation.

Is Bromley poor?
Overview. Bromley is an outer London borough located in south-east London. It has one of the lowest rates of child poverty in London, with 24% of children living in households in poverty, compared to 38% for the typical London borough.
Is Bromley the biggest borough in London?
Bromley is the largest borough in Greater London by area, and it is also one of the most rural. Most of the population lives in the east and west of the borough, or in Bromley Town Centre. Westerham Heights, in the south, is the highest point in London at 245 metres. The Prime Meridian also passes through Bromley.
